The Core i9-13900KF is a slightly slower gaming CPU than the Core i9-14900KS, however, it's a better value for money, as it's $156.39 cheaper!
Advantages of the Core i9-13900KF
- Up to 27% cheaper – $426.00 vs $582.39
- A better value for money for gaming
- Consumes up to 17% less energy – 125 vs 150 Watts
Advantages of the Core i9-14900KS
- A slightly faster CPU for gaming
- Can run games without a dedicated GPU as it has integrated graphics

Specifications
Comparison of all specifications
Core i9-13900KF | SpecificationsComparison of all specifications | Core i9-14900KS |
---|---|---|
General | ||
Sep 27th, 2022 | Release Date | Mar 14th, 2024 |
$564.00 | MSRP | $689.00 |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
Intel Socket 1700 | Socket | Intel Socket 1700 |
Raptor Lake-S | Codename | Raptor Lake-R |
125 W | Power Consumption | 150 W |
Performance | ||
24 | Cores | 24 |
32 | Threads | 32 |
3.0 GHz | Base Frequency | 3.2 GHz |
5.8 GHz | Turbo Frequency | 6.2 GHz |
36 MB | L3 Cache | 36 MB |
Other Features | ||
DDR4 @ 3200 MHz, DDR5 @ 5600 MHz | RAM | DDR4 @ 3200 MHz, DDR5 @ 5600 MHz |
No | Integrated Graphics | UHD Graphics 770 |
Yes | Overclockable | Yes |
